Directions

  1. Mix chicken, onions and walnuts in food processor bowl. Cover and process by using quick on-and-off motions until finely chopped.
  2. Add 1/3 cup of the poppy seed dressing; process only until mixed.
  3. Mix remaining dressing and the cream cheese spread in small bowl with spoon until smooth.
  4. Spread cream cheese mixture evenly over entire surface of tortillas.
  5. Remove white rib from lettuce leaves. Press lettuce into cream cheese, tearing to fit and leaving top 2 inches of tortillas uncovered.
  6. Spread chicken mixture over lettuce.
  7. Sprinkle strawberries over chicken.
  8. Firmly roll up tortillas, beginning at bottom. Wrap each roll in plastic wrap. Refrigerate at least 1 hour. Trim ends of each roll.
  9. Cut rolls into 1/2- to 3/4-inch slices.
